On-line trainer wins praise


By Private Andrew Hetherington

THE ADF has won a prestigious achievement award for its innovative use of information technology with the CAMPUS on-line learning system.

The Computerworld Information Technology Awards Foundation, based in Massachusetts in the United States, has made the award in the category of education and academia.

Secretary of Defence Ric Smith accepted the award and said, with the development of CAMPUS the ADF had implemented Australia’s largest whole-of-organisation flexible learning strategy, and had set a global benchmark.

“This is an outstanding achievement and is one that places the on-line CAMPUS facility unambiguously as world’s best practice,” Mr Smith said. “The award reflects positively on Defence and is a great credit to all those involved in the development of the CAMPUS system.”

CAMPUS provides training in areas ranging from administrative business skills through to frontline operational and peacekeeping operations.
